Think I'm in need of some shed help as the airbag light is staying on.
Have tried my reset gadget on it but to no avail. Just not had chance to investigate it further.
Hi, had same problem... managed to fix it . Mine was due to either seat belt tensioner fault (replaced with one from scrap yard) and/or a loose connection under seat where seat belt occupancy sensor connected). Bit of soldering and light then reset!! Yay!! Dave
